                <![CDATA[live satellite positions + open telemetry.

A real-time control room for the ~23 cubesats currently broadcasting decodable open telemetry: their positions on a MapLibre globe, their batteries, temperatures and currents decoded locally from their actual radio frames, and the network of volunteer ground stations that heard them — self-hosted in Europe on one small server.

                <![CDATA[Official data.gouv.fr Model Context Protocol (MCP) server that allows AI chatbots to search, explore, and analyze datasets from the French national Open Data platform, directly through conversation.

                <![CDATA[CredData (Credential Dataset) is a set of files including credentials in open source projects. CredData includes suspicious lines with manual review results and more information such as credential types for each suspicious line.

CredData can be used to develop new tools or improve existing tools. Furthermore, using the benchmark result of the CredData, users can choose a proper tool among open source credential scanning tools according to their use case.                 <![CDATA[The Arc Virtual Cell Atlas is a collection of high quality, curated, open datasets assembled for the purpose of accelerating the creation of virtual cell models. The Atlas includes both observational and perturbational data from over 300 million cells (and growing).

                <![CDATA[Uncover evidence of internet censorship worldwide. Open data collected by the global OONI community.

OONI Explorer is an open data resource on internet censorship around the world.

Since 2012, millions of network measurements have been collected from more than 200 countries. OONI Explorer sheds light on internet censorship and other forms of network interference worldwide.

                <![CDATA[Supported by Google Ideas, the GDELT Project monitors the world&amp;#039;s broadcast, print, and web news from nearly every corner of every country in over 100 languages and identifies the people, locations, organizations, counts, themes, sources, emotions, counts, quotes and events driving our global society every second of every day, creating a free open platform for computing on the entire world.]]>
